Departures.
[ Sherman Oaks, California: [: Ninja Press, 2019. One of 70 copies designed, printed, and bound by Carolee Campbell with assistance from Farida Baldonado Sunada of the Ophelia Press. Text was printed by Gaylord Schanilec at his press, Midnight Paper Sales, in Wisconsin. Eight additional hors commerce copies were also produced. With six mounted full-color photographs by Carolee Campbell of wood engravings by Gaylord Schanilec. Photographs were printed digitally on Japanese Nyodo-shi paper. Text was letterpress printed from entirely hand-set type on Langley paper handmade in England in 1986. With small triangular text ornaments in red and black throughout. A fine copy, as new, signed in pencil on the colophon by Gaylord Shanilec. Handmade Belgian flax paper wrappers stitched with silver thread and decorated with a mounted color photograph. Edges untrimmed. Quarto. [ 12 ] ff. Item #16710
Gaylord Schanilec (b. 1955) is a poet, a wood engraver, and the proprietor of Midnight Paper Sales. Since 1987, he has produced nineteen books and over twenty broadsides, which include poems by Joyce Carol Oates, Saadi Yousef, Robert Bly, and Gregory Orr. Schanilec’s most extensive project to date has been Lac Des Pleurs: Report from Lake Pepin, which is described on his website as a “seven-year odyssey” of photography, wood engraving, commentary, and typography that culminated in 2015. The photographs included in Departures are from Schanilec’s engravings in Lac Des Pleurs, which were based on illustrations in Aldus Manutius’ Hypnerotomachia Poliphili.
